Custom Columns Types

Custom Columns can be set as Amount ($), Checkbox, Date and Time Picker, Date Picker, Email, Number, Phone, Text, or URL. These fields can appear on the Order Details page and in the customer's online (Order Confirmation view).


Amount ($)

Ideal for showing additional costs or discounts.

πŸ—’οΈ Note: there is an option to have no decimals or to include up to 4 decimal places.


Checkbox

Ideal for simple Yes/No or Completed/Not Completed indicators.


Date and Time Picker

Ideal for scheduling and deadline-related information.

Date Picker

Ideal for specific date information (e.g. delivered date or design reviewed).

Email

Ideal for alternate contact or notification address to include.


Number

Ideal for numeric data that does not require dollar sign.

πŸ—’οΈ Note: there is an option to have no decimals or to include up to 4 decimal places.


Phone

Ideal for storing secondary contact number.


Text

Ideal for Project or Job name or any customer-spefic information.


URL

Ideal for adding links to external websites, documents, product pages, or map locations.


Adding custom columns (can be created by Administrators only)

  • Select the column picker icon

  • Click Add custom column

  • Enter a column name

  • Select the column type

  • Choose where the column will be displayed by toggling on or off

  • Save

πŸ—’οΈ Notes:

  • Newly added custom columns appear at the end of the Dynamic Table

  • Custom columns added by an Administrator will be visible to all users who have access to the Sales Order main page

  • Each row in a custom column can be updated directly on the Sales Orders main page. Click the row next to an order, enter the details, then click outside the text box to save.


Editing custom columns

Right-clicking a custom column opens options to:

  • Edit (column name and display settings)

  • Delete

  • Sort column

  • Hide column

  • Move to start

  • Move to end

πŸ—’οΈ Note:

  • If a custom column is hidden, it will still be available through the column picker icon

  • If a custom column type needs to be changed, Administrators can simply delete the existing custom column and add a new one with the correct column type.
